2. Marseille City Tour Half-Day

Step back into the history and culture of the beautiful city of Marseille, which is in the midst of enjoying a cultural renaissance, which you will see during this 4-hour tour. This city was the European Capital of Culture in 2013. Your guide will pick you up in the morning at Marseille cruise terminal. Your adventure begins with a visit to the city’s historical center. Walk along the Vieux Port dotted with shops and restaurants, while your tour guide reveals the port’s journey from a 6th century trade post to the area’s hub of maritime activity in the 19th century. From there, you will head to the colonnade-lined Palais Longchamp at the terminus of the Durance River. Inaugurated in 1869 as a monument to commemorate the connection of Marseille to a new waterway network, the combination large fountain-waterfall-water tower has two wings housing the city’s natural history museum and Musée des Beaux-Arts. Continue with the stunning Basilica of Notre Dame de la Garde. Situated on the foundation of an ancient fort, this building rests on the highest elevation in the city overlooking Marseille. Consecrated in 1864 to replace an 11th century church by the same name, the Basilica has a lower crypt built in the Romanesque style and an upper church built in the Neo-Byzantine style using green limestone from Florence. Take some pictures before ending your tour.  When your tour is finished, your guide will drive you back to Marseille port cruise terminal.
